Linux如何建站
什么是Linux建站?
Linux建站是指使用Linux操作系统作为服务器,搭建一个个人或企业的网站。Linux作为开源操作系统,具有稳定、安全和灵活的特点,非常适合用于建站。
为什么选择Linux建站?
Linux建站有许多好处。首先,Linux操作系统是开源的,这意味着你可以免费获取并自由修改、分发。其次,Linux操作系统具有稳定性和安全性,不易受到病毒和恶意攻击的影响。此外,Linux还支持多种不同的编程语言和数据库,使得开发和扩展网站变得更加灵活和方便。
如何开始Linux建站?
要开始Linux建站,你需要以下几个步骤:
1. 选择合适的Linux发行版:有许多不同的Linux发行版可供选择,例如Ubuntu、CentOS、Debian等。你可以根据自己的需求和熟悉程度选择适合你的发行版。
2. 安装Linux操作系统:根据你选择的Linux发行版,按照相应的安装指南进行操作系统的安装。你可以选择在物理服务器上安装,也可以选择在虚拟机上进行安装。
3. 安装必要的软件和服务:在Linux操作系统上建站,你需要安装一些必要的软件和服务,例如Web服务器(如Apache或Nginx)、数据库(如MySQL或PostgreSQL)、PHP等。你可以使用包管理器来安装这些软件和服务。
4. 配置和优化:一旦你完成了软件和服务的安装,你需要进行相应的配置和优化。例如,配置Web服务器的虚拟主机、设置数据库的用户名和密码、调整服务器的性能等。
有哪些常用的建站工具?
在Linux建站中,有许多常用的建站工具可供选择,包括:
1. WordPress:WordPress是一种流行的开源内容管理系统(CMS),可以帮助你快速搭建和管理网站。
2. Joomla:Joomla也是一种常用的开源CMS,提供了丰富的扩展和模板,适用于各种类型的网站。
3. Drupal:Drupal是另一个功能强大的开源CMS,适用于需要高度自定义和灵活性的网站。
4. Magento:Magento是一种专注于电子商务的开源平台,适合建设在线商店。
如何保护Linux建站的安全性?
保护Linux建站的安全性非常重要。以下是一些保护Linux建站安全的方法:
1. 更新和升级软件:定期更新和升级操作系统、软件和服务,以获得最新的安全修复和功能改进。
2. 使用防火墙:配置和启用防火墙,限制对服务器的访问,只允许必要的端口和服务。
3. 设置强密码:使用强密码来保护服务器的登录和数据库的访问。
4. 定期备份:定期备份网站的数据和配置文件,以防止数据丢失。
5. 安装安全插件:根据网站的需求,安装适当的安全插件来提供额外的安全保护。
Linux建站的成本如何?
Linux建站的成本相对较低。Linux操作系统本身是免费的,而且大多数的建站工具和软件也是开源的,可以免费获取和使用。你只需要支付服务器的租用费用、域名注册费用和可能的云服务费用。此外,如果你需要专业的建站服务,可能还需要支付额外的费用。